Although I have a wide interest in older computers, I worked with PDP-11's extremely extensively 'back in the day', and consider them perhaps the most elegant architecture ever devised (the power and flexibility they obtained with only 16-bit wide instructions were a revelation when they first appeared), so I started out by focusing on them. I also worked a lot on early UNIX (whose bang/buck ratio has never been surpassed, and almost certainly never will), back when it only ran on PDP-11's, before it was portable.
